Omicho Market
Omicho Market, known as Kanazawa’s “Kitchen of the City”, is a vibrant marketplace bursting with around 170 shops selling fresh seafood, vegetables, fruits, and local dishes. If you go there, you can enjoy
(1)Enjoy the unique experience of food walking-tasting a variety of local specialties. Such as Sushi, Kanazawa style croquettes, Oden(Japanese Hot Pot), fresh fruits and grilled skewers.
(2)Capture vibrant senses of market life and delicious food, ideal for memorable photos.

Kanazawa Higashi Chayagai Kaikaro
Higashi Chaya District (Geisha District) is one of Kanazawa’s most famous traditional tea house quarters, offering a beautifully preserved glimpse into Edo-period Japan.
(1) Wander along atmospheric stone-paved streets lined with historic wooden tea houses featuring distinctive latticed windows and vermilion-colored walls, many designated as cultural heritage sites.
(2) Experience traditional culture through opportunities such as gold leaf crafts, tea ceremonies, and sampling local sweets and matcha in charming cafes.

Ruins of Nagamachi Bukeyashiki
Nagamachi Samurai District is an area where you can feel the lifestyle of samurai. Because Kanazawa was largely untouched by air raids during World War II, the atmosphere from the samurai era has been remarkably preserved.
(1) The area features scenic canals, historic samurai residences like the Nomura-ke, (Entrance fee is required.) and peaceful gardens, allowing visitors to experience the daily life of samurai in the Edo period (17-19century.)
(2) It is famous for its preserved earthen walls and stone-paved streets, creating a traditional atmosphere just steps away from Kanazawa’s modern city center.
